Q: How does the circle breathing circuit with an adjustable APL valve function in this anaesthesia delivery system?
A: The circle breathing circuit minimizes gas wastage and rebreathes exhaled gases after CO2 removal, with the adjustable APL (Adjustable Pressure Limiting) valve allowing precise control of system pressure for patient safety during manual ventilation.
